A 5-year-old girl was taken to the hospital after a fire at a home in Dupo early Thursday morning. Fire crews were called to the house along Edwin Drive after midnight. The fire started at the back of the home and flames and smoke could be seen coming through the roof. There was damage to the upper side of the home and to the back deck. At this time, it unknown if the young girl suffered injuries in the fire or was taken to the hospital as a precaution. Fire officials have not released information on what caused the fire.

A fire engine shut down because of a tight Peoria budget last year during the COVID-19 pandemic will start operating again Monday. Opponents in the Peoria City Council's 6-4 vote Tuesday to restore the engine company charged the discussion came out of nowhere, and questioned whether it was legal since it wasn't formally on the agenda as part of their continuing budget debate. City Attorney Chrissie Kaputska told councilmembers that as long as the Fire Department had the funds on hand to staff the engine, it was well within the city manager's power to approve. At-large councilmembers Sid Ruckriegel, Zach Oyler and John Kelly, and 3rd District councilmember Tim Riggenbach, voted no. Denis Cyr, the 5th District member, was absent because of a death in the family.

A massive amount of area first responder brothers and sisters escorted the late Pontoon Beach Police Officer Tyler Timmins home Wednesday afternoon. Young and old filled with emotion, lined all sides of Sixth Street in Wood River as Officer Timmins was carried by a Granite City first responder vehicle to Marks Mortuary. Timmins, 36, was shot outside the Speedway Convenience store on Tuesday morning and later died at a St. Louis hospital. His body was brought back in the large procession beginning at 12:30 p.m. Wednesday from St. Louis, then across the Poplar Street Bridge, Illinois Route 111, and eventually Downtown Wood River. Marks Mortuary in Wood River is in charge of the arrangements for Officer Timmins. As of noon Wednesday, Marks Mortuary said nothing definite had been decided on the funeral or visitation.

VIDEO: A massive fire has spread to three homes in Pittsburgh's Perry South neighborhood. The fire broke out early on Thursday morning in the 300 block of Kennedy Avenue. Several fire companies are on the scene battling the flames. According to Pittsburgh Public Safety, the residents of the homes were able to make it out safely. Crews on the scene said the residents of the first house that caught fire were forced to their roof, called 911, and had to jump off. They were not hurt and did not have to go to the hospital. All three homes were heavily damaged and lost their roofs. However, the cause of the fire is unknown and the investigation will determine if these homes are a total loss. Firefighters are asking people to avoid the area.

With a vaccine mandate for FDNY members days away from kicking in, officials warned fire companies across New York City could close and ambulances could be taken off streets because of worker shortages. Many firefighters and emergency medical workers are still unvaccinated and have no plans of getting the COVID jab. An estimated 20 percent of fire units could close, officials said. New Yorkers could see around 20 percent fewer ambulances on the road. FDNY Commissioner Daniel Nigro said the agency has plans in place to mitigate staffing issues. "The Department must manage the unfortunate fact that a portion of our workforce has refused to comply with a vaccine mandate for all city employees," he said. "We will use all means at our disposal, including mandatory overtime, mutual aid from other EMS providers, and significant changes to the schedules of our members. We will ensure the continuity of operations and safety of all those we have sworn oaths to serve."

Is there a haunted fire station in North Charleston? A couple of firefighters seem convinced an entity named "The Hag" is residing in old Station 6. The city of North Charleston released a video ominously titled "Is this place haunted?" on YouTube today where two fire personnel tell about their encounters with the mysterious spirit. The Hag is supposedly known to move chairs, turn faucets on and off, wake up firefighters and hold them down when they are trying to move. We think she needs to make up her mind. "One individual actually said he saw the outline of a shadow," one official said in the video. "He was in the top bunk, so the shadow was quite tall, and the shadow actually told him to get out of bed. He tried to get out of bed, but it felt like something was holding him down."

A Delray Beach firefighter is running in the New York City Marathon on Nov. 7. He's hoping his run will help bring to light an important issue. Tyler Adams has been with Delray Beach Fire Rescue for 12 years. He's been preparing for a big race that is scheduled to occur in less than two weeks. "I was fortunate enough to be chosen by the "Movember" charity to run the New York Marathon in the 50th anniversary of the marathon," Adams said. November is a month where men will grow out their facial hair to help promote awareness for prostate cancer. "I don't grow a mustache that well," Adams joked. With his mustache and all, Adams said he has been a big advocate for awareness after seeing men in the department get diagnosed -- even losing a fellow firefighter several years ago.

The Springfield Fire Department may begin registering new firefighters into the U.S. Department of Labor Registered Apprenticeship Program. In September, Springfield City Council voted to approve an agreement between the Springfield Fire Department and the U.S. Department of Labor. The fire department sought out the program to provide opportunities for firefighters to earn credit while accomplishing their formal fire academy and fire service-related on-the-job training. Assistant Chief Olan Morelan says the goal of this partnership is to help with the recruitment and retention of firefighters. "It gives the firefighters credit for what they're already doing and the training they've received," Assistant Chief Morelan says." SFD has registered 46 firefighters as apprentices in their new program. The program consists of 6,000 hours of on-the-job training for firefighters new to the fire service. Assistant Chief Morelan says that takes about three years to complete.
